Council approves HDR work orders for lift-station relocation and force main routing; reimbursement resolution adopted
Summary
The council approved two HDR Engineering work orders — $62,000 for lift-station site assessment and $83,700 for force-main routing to Houston Southwest Wastewater Plant — and adopted a resolution declaring intent to reimburse expenditures from future tax-exempt bonds.
Bel Air — The City Council on Sept. 8 approved two work orders under an existing professional services agreement with HDR Engineering Inc. to advance design and investigation for two major wastewater projects, and adopted a resolution preserving the city’s option to reimburse eligible project costs from future tax-exempt bond proceeds.
City staff and engineering consultant Beth Jones described work order No. 3 (not to exceed $62,000) as a site investigation and utility coordination to relocate the existing Bel Air lift station that currently sits in a median. The work will include underground utility…
